Pulse modulators generate high power pulses which are used for various industrial applications. This paper discusses the development of transfer function model for pulse modulator. An appropriate mathematical model facilitates the analysis and design of the pulse modulator. The validation of the developed model has been carried out by comparing the simulation results with the experimental results.
